Google provides a specific installer link that bypasses Windows administrative privileges. This installer places the browser files within the local user directory instead of the system-wide Program Files, making it easy to convert into a portable app.

Chrome Canary Portable: The Ultimate Guide for Developers Google Chrome Canary is the "bleeding edge" version of the Chrome browser, updated daily with the latest experimental features and APIs. While Google provides official installers, many developers prefer a to test new web technologies without affecting their primary browser setup or leaving leftovers on a host system. Go to portableapps.com/apps/internet/google-chrome-canary-portable Click "Download Now" – this is a launcher, not the full browser. Run it, and it fetches the latest Google build.

Canary updates almost daily. Unlike the stable portable version, you will need to manually replace the binaries in the App folder frequently to stay current with the latest experimental features.
